Summary:

The 01748 zip code is home to a single high school, Hopkinton High School, which has consistently demonstrated exceptional academic performance and student outcomes. This standout institution serves the Hopkinton community, ranking among the top 5 high schools in Massachusetts and earning a 5-star rating from SchoolDigger.

Hopkinton High School boasts an impressive 98.6% four-year graduation rate, significantly higher than the state average, and a remarkable 0.0% dropout rate, indicating the school's ability to effectively support and retain its students. The school's students consistently outperform their peers statewide on MCAS Next Generation assessments, with proficiency rates in English Language Arts, Mathematics, Science, and Biology that are 30-40 percentage points above the state average.

The school's strong performance is further reflected in its relatively low student-teacher ratio of 14.4 to 1 and its per-student spending of $15,978, which is higher than the state average. These investments in resources and support contribute to the school's exceptional academic outcomes and its reputation as a standout educational institution in the state of Massachusetts.
